Name an association based on a TypeName-VerbPhrase-TypeName format where the verb phrase creates a sequence that is readable and meaningful in the model context. |
Association names should start with a capital letter, since an association represents a classifier of links between instances; in the UML, classifiers should start with a capital letter. Two common and equally legal formats for a compound association name are:
Paid-by
PaidBy
In Figure 11.6, the default direction to read an association name is left to right or top to bottom. This is not a UML default, but a common convention.
